Background & Context
RWE, one of Germany’s largest energy companies, has reached an agreement with the Trump administration to exit three planned offshore wind projects in the United States. Under the agreement, the U.S.
government will reimburse RWE around $1.22 billion. RWE will relinquish offshore wind leases off the coasts of New York, California, and Louisiana.
The projects were still in an early stage of development. At the same time, the company has announced about $1.2 billion in investments in U.S.
gas projects. The agreement comes as the Trump administration opposes further expansion of offshore wind development in the United States.
